b"Author and reporter, Anya Kamenetz is back on the podcast to talk about her new book The Stolen Year: How Covid Changed Children\\u2019s Lives, And Where We Go Now. The Stolen Year is a powerful look at how the pandemic disrupted children\\u2019s lives \\u2014 their learning, mental health, and overall well-being. The Stolen Year isn\\u2019t written specifically for parents of differently wired children, but I thought it was important to really explore what the research and data shows the cost of the past two years has been for our most valuable resource \\u2013 our children, as well as consider the question \\u2013 where do we go from here?\\nDuring our conversation we talked about the trends on decreasing graduation rates, the impact of food scarcity on children and adolescents, and caregiver depression.
